We are determined not to shy away from any means of transportation during our trip, as the lust of unseen places is fuel enough to drive us forward. Okay, its a nice thought, but for now we are still holding true, and only two weeks since departure.

In our latest leg of transport we found ourselves aboard a ferry, departing from Osaka and bound for Shanghai. This was in part to avoid outrageous airfares departing Japan. Talk about a captivated audience. Those airline marketers in Japan live on easy street.

This was our route from Osaka, Japan to Shanghai, China. How glorious! Our means know no bounds!
